Michigan Apartment Markets and Valuation Issues
This seven hour seminar reviews the state of major Michigan apartment markets including historical vacancy levels, historical and forecast construction and recent sales.
Valuation issues including deferred maintenance atypical vacancy issues and functional obsolescence are explored. Valuation issues in the income approach including
operating expense ratios, reserves for replacement and the development of capitalization rates are discussed.
Niche properties including student housing and fractured properties (condominiums) are illustrated.
A case study on an apartment property is discussed to demonstrate proper techniques.
